The NewCAJE conference is a vibrant gathering that unites Jewish educators and professionals to strengthen the Jewish community through education. Rooted in the legacy of CAJE, NewCAJE fosters innovation, collaboration, and inspiration. The conference offers space for sharing best practicesexploring new ideas, and deepening Jewish and educational learning. Committed to inclusivity and pluralism, it welcomes educators from all backgrounds, creating a supportive network that empowers them to make a lasting impact.

This workshop will help students identify antisemitism online and distinguish it from legitimate criticism of Israel. Using real examples, students will learn to analyze content, stay safe, and engage responsibly. Topics include media literacy, historical context, and digital responsibility, empowering students to recognize and respond to online hate..
